How much do part time laundry jobs pay per hour?

As of May 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time laundry in the United States is $14.94,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.46 and $16.35 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the typical responsibilities and work schedule for a part-time laundry attendant?

As a part-time laundry attendant, your main responsibilities usually include sorting, washing, drying, folding, and sometimes ironing laundry items. You may also be responsible for operating commercial laundry machines, monitoring supply levels, and ensuring a clean work environment. Schedules for part-time positions often include evenings, weekends, or flexible shifts to accommodate busy periods, making it ideal for those seeking work-life balance or secondary employment. You'll often work independently or as part of a small team, and good attention to detail is essential to ensure quality results for customers.

What are part time laundry jobs?

Part time laundry jobs involve working in laundromats, hotels, hospitals, or other facilities to wash, dry, fold, and sometimes iron clothing and linens. Employees typically operate laundry machines, sort items by color and fabric, and ensure garments are cleaned to standard. These positions often require attention to detail, basic knowledge of laundry equipment, and the ability to work efficiently. Part time schedules can vary, making them suitable for students or individuals seeking flexible work hours.
